[hibernate-commits] [hibernate/hibernate-orm] 3aad75: Improved Hibernate support for SAP HANA

GitHub noreply at github.com
Thu Sep 21 13:05:27 EDT 2017


  Branch: refs/heads/master
  Home:   https://github.com/hibernate/hibernate-orm
  Commit: 3aad752b0449ccfe2f77ae692befb3749ab9e103
      https://github.com/hibernate/hibernate-orm/commit/3aad752b0449ccfe2f77ae692befb3749ab9e103
  Author: Jonathan Bregler <jonathan.bregler at sap.com>
  Date:   2017-09-21 (Thu, 21 Sep 2017)

  Changed paths:
    M build.gradle
    M databases.gradle
    M documentation/documentation.gradle
    M documentation/src/test/java/org/hibernate/userguide/mapping/basic/NClobTest.java
    M etc/hibernate.properties.template
    M hibernate-core/src/main/java/org/hibernate/dialect/AbstractHANADialect.java
    M hibernate-core/src/main/java/org/hibernate/dialect/HANAColumnStoreDialect.java
    M hibernate-core/src/main/java/org/hibernate/dialect/HANARowStoreDialect.java
    A hibernate-core/src/main/java/org/hibernate/dialect/identity/HANAIdentityColumnSupport.java
    A hibernate-core/src/main/java/org/hibernate/engine/jdbc/connections/spi/HANAMultiTenantConnectionProvider.java
    M hibernate-core/src/test/java/org/hibernate/id/FlushIdGenTest.java
    M hibernate-core/src/test/java/org/hibernate/id/SequenceValueExtractor.java
    M hibernate-core/src/test/java/org/hibernate/jpa/test/criteria/fetchscroll/CriteriaToScrollableResultsFetchTest.java
    M hibernate-core/src/test/java/org/hibernate/jpa/test/criteria/nulliteral/CriteriaLiteralInSelectExpressionTest.java
    M hibernate-core/src/test/java/org/hibernate/jpa/test/ops/GetLoadTest.java
    M hibernate-core/src/test/java/org/hibernate/jpa/test/ops/PersistTest.java
    M hibernate-core/src/test/java/org/hibernate/jpa/test/schemagen/SchemaScriptFileGenerationTest.java
    M hibernate-core/src/test/java/org/hibernate/test/annotations/list/ListMappingTest.java
    M hibernate-core/src/test/java/org/hibernate/test/annotations/xml/hbm/HbmWithIdentityTest.java
    M hibernate-core/src/test/java/org/hibernate/test/array/ArrayTest.java
    M hibernate-core/src/test/java/org/hibernate/test/collection/bag/PersistentBagTest.java
    M hibernate-core/src/test/java/org/hibernate/test/collection/original/CollectionTest.java
    M hibernate-core/src/test/java/org/hibernate/test/criteria/SessionCreateQueryFromCriteriaTest.java
    M hibernate-core/src/test/java/org/hibernate/test/event/collection/AbstractCollectionEventTest.java
    M hibernate-core/src/test/java/org/hibernate/test/event/collection/association/AbstractAssociationCollectionEventTest.java
    M hibernate-core/src/test/java/org/hibernate/test/join/OptionalJoinTest.java
    M hibernate-core/src/test/java/org/hibernate/test/legacy/MasterDetailTest.java
    M hibernate-core/src/test/java/org/hibernate/test/legacy/MultiTableTest.java
    M hibernate-core/src/test/java/org/hibernate/test/legacy/ParentChildTest.java
    M hibernate-core/src/test/java/org/hibernate/test/onetoone/link/OneToOneLinkTest.java
    M hibernate-core/src/test/java/org/hibernate/test/ops/CreateTest.java
    M hibernate-core/src/test/java/org/hibernate/test/ops/MergeTest.java
    M hibernate-core/src/test/java/org/hibernate/test/schemaupdate/ImplicitCompositeKeyJoinTest.java
    M hibernate-core/src/test/java/org/hibernate/test/schemaupdate/SchemaExportTest.java
    M hibernate-core/src/test/java/org/hibernate/test/schemaupdate/SchemaMigrationTargetScriptCreationTest.java
    M hibernate-core/src/test/java/org/hibernate/test/schemaupdate/SchemaUpdateGeneratingOnlyScriptFileTest.java
    M hibernate-core/src/test/java/org/hibernate/test/stateless/StatelessSessionQueryTest.java
    M hibernate-core/src/test/java/org/hibernate/test/type/TimeAndTimestampTest.java
    M hibernate-core/src/test/java/org/hibernate/test/typeoverride/TypeOverrideTest.java
    M hibernate-envers/src/test/java/org/hibernate/envers/test/integration/collection/StringMapLobTest.java
    M hibernate-envers/src/test/java/org/hibernate/envers/test/integration/collection/StringMapNationalizedLobTest.java
    M hibernate-envers/src/test/java/org/hibernate/envers/test/integration/modifiedflags/DetachedEntityTest.java
    M hibernate-envers/src/test/java/org/hibernate/envers/test/integration/query/MaximalizePropertyQuery.java
    M hibernate-envers/src/test/java/org/hibernate/envers/test/integration/query/SimpleQuery.java
    A hibernate-spatial/databases/hana/matrix.gradle
    A hibernate-spatial/databases/hana/resources/hibernate.properties
    M hibernate-spatial/hibernate-spatial.gradle
    M hibernate-spatial/matrix-test.sh
    A hibernate-spatial/src/main/java/org/hibernate/spatial/dialect/hana/HANAGeometryTypeDescriptor.java
    A hibernate-spatial/src/main/java/org/hibernate/spatial/dialect/hana/HANAPointTypeDescriptor.java
    A hibernate-spatial/src/main/java/org/hibernate/spatial/dialect/hana/HANASpatialAggregate.java
    A hibernate-spatial/src/main/java/org/hibernate/spatial/dialect/hana/HANASpatialDialect.java
    A hibernate-spatial/src/main/java/org/hibernate/spatial/dialect/hana/HANASpatialFunction.java
    A hibernate-spatial/src/main/java/org/hibernate/spatial/dialect/hana/HANASpatialUtils.java
    M hibernate-spatial/src/test/java/org/hibernate/spatial/testing/TestSupportFactories.java
    A hibernate-spatial/src/test/java/org/hibernate/spatial/testing/dialects/hana/HANADataSourceUtils.java
    A hibernate-spatial/src/test/java/org/hibernate/spatial/testing/dialects/hana/HANAExpectationsFactory.java
    A hibernate-spatial/src/test/java/org/hibernate/spatial/testing/dialects/hana/HANAExpressionTemplate.java
    A hibernate-spatial/src/test/java/org/hibernate/spatial/testing/dialects/hana/HANATestSupport.java
    A hibernate-spatial/src/test/resources/hana/test-hana-data-set.xml
    M hibernate-spatial/src/test/resources/hibernate.properties
    M hibernate-testing/src/main/java/org/hibernate/testing/transaction/TransactionUtil.java
    M libraries.gradle

  Log Message:
  -----------
  Improved Hibernate support for SAP HANA

- Identity column support
- Spatial support
- Various minor improvements in HANA dialects


  Commit: 85dcac95d0064590f0a3527654e714b9038c1ac0
      https://github.com/hibernate/hibernate-orm/commit/85dcac95d0064590f0a3527654e714b9038c1ac0
  Author: Jonathan Bregler <jonathan.bregler at sap.com>
  Date:   2017-09-21 (Thu, 21 Sep 2017)

  Changed paths:
    R hibernate-core/src/main/java/org/hibernate/engine/jdbc/connections/spi/HANAMultiTenantConnectionProvider.java
    M hibernate-spatial/src/main/java/org/hibernate/spatial/dialect/hana/HANASpatialAggregate.java
    M libraries.gradle

  Log Message:
  -----------
  Improved Hibernate support for SAP HANA part 2

- implement PR comments


Compare: https://github.com/hibernate/hibernate-orm/compare/7a897d528567...85dcac95d006


More information about the hibernate-commits mailing list